Mobility Shower Installation in Pinellas County, FL

Mobility shower installation services focus on creating accessible and functional shower spaces tailored to the needs of homeowners requiring enhanced safety and ease of use. These projects often involve modifying existing bathrooms or designing new setups to include features such as walk-in entries, low-threshold or curbless showers, grab bars, and non-slip flooring. Property owners typically seek these services to improve independence for individuals with mobility challenges, accommodate aging-in-place modifications, or enhance overall bathroom safety for family members.

Before requesting mobility shower install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of modifications needed for their space, the types of accessible features available, and any structural considerations that may impact the project. It's also common to inquire about the materials used, the customization options for specific accessibility needs, and how the installation process will integrate with existing bathroom layouts. Clear communication about these aspects helps ensure the finished shower meets safety standards and personal preferences.

FAQ

Mobility Shower Installation Questions

What is a mobility shower installation? It involves modifying or installing showers designed for easy access and safety, often featuring grab bars, seats, and non-slip surfaces.

Who benefits from mobility shower installations? Property owners with limited mobility, seniors, or individuals recovering from injuries may find these showers safer and more accessible.

What types of modifications are common? Common modifications include installing grab bars, adjustable shower seats, handheld showerheads, and barrier-free or low-threshold designs.

Is a mobility shower suitable for all bathrooms? Many bathrooms can be adapted, but the suitability depends on space and existing plumbing; a professional assessment can determine the best options.
